Unique Opportunities
Georgian was the first college to establish a Collaborative BScN program in Ontario and set the benchmark by becoming the first institution to receive a seven-year accreditation. Georgian's program is regarded as the model of excellence when other colleges review their curriculum. Several unique opportunities for clinical are available at Georgian:
- Dominican Republic trip (working in clinics in the Dominican)
- Christian Island trip (working with native communities on a joint diabetic screening research project)
- Simulation Lab (non-threatening, hands-on simulated hospital learning environment at the Barrie campus)
